Awards

Financial assistance for student presenters

The International Biometric Society Australasian Region is offering up to two (2) awards to students who are intending to present their research at the Biometrics by the Beach conference in Coffs Harbour in December 2007.

The aim of these awards is to provide financial assistance to students to support their professional development and to encourage networking with professional peers. Each award will cover the

  1. cost of registration for the conference, and
  2. cost of registration to attend one of the two short courses on offer on Sunday 2 December.

If successful applicants have already registered for either or both of these, reimbursement will be made.

To be eligible for these awards, applicants must:

  1. Be qualified to register as a student (following guidelines advised on www.biometrics.org.au/conf/registration.html)
  2. Submit their abstract with their application. Oral or poster presentations are valid.
  3. Provide a single page academic CV.
  4. Provide a one-paragraph summary on why they are requesting funding and how attending the conference will be beneficial to their career.

The closing date for applications is Friday 2 November, 2007. Please email your application to Warren Muller by 5 p.m. on this date. Note that no late applications will be accepted.

Awards will be judged by members of the society on the basis of merit. Successful applicants will be required to meet other conference expenses, such as travel, accommodation and meals not covered by the conference fee. Successful applicants will be notified of their success by Friday 9 November 2007 to enable registration by the deadline.

Prizes

Prizes will be awarded for the best talk and poster (as deemed by a panel of judges) presented by a "young" statistician. To be considered for these awards, you will need to indicate so by checking the appropriate box in the abstract template. To be eligible, a person must be a member of the IBS Australasian Region at the time of submitting an abstract and a 'young statistician', which shall mean a person who is studying either full-time or part-time without age limit, or a person who has graduated with a Bachelor's Degree (in a biometrical-related field) within the last five years, or a person awarded a Postgraduate Degree within the past year.
